Victor MacFarlane, the public face of DC United and the team's quest for a new stadium, has sold his stake in the team to Will Chang.
McFarlane was the first African-American owner of an MLS franchise. He and Chang paid $33 million for the franchise two years ago.
"Though I now change my status from owner and fan to just fan, I plan to continue to champion D.C. United's goals -- on and off the field," MacFarlane said in a statement.
